Durham Regional Police Service (DRPS) yesterday reported a heart warming story that occurred earlier in the year.
On February 11, DRPS’ East Division 911 Communications received a call for a male who had fallen into Lake Ontario.
Within minutes, officers arrived on scene and located the male and pulled him out of the freezing water.
BWC footage captured the quick thinking and brave actions by the officers involved.
DRPS also reported that due to the “excellent work and quick thinking by our officers”, they were happy that the outcome was a positive one and the man is doing well.
